QUAKER VANISHING OATMEAL RAISIN COOKIES RECIPE RECIPE ...



Quaker Vanishing Oatmeal Raisin Cookies Recipe Recipe ... image

Set out a plate of these sweetly spiced cookies and watch them vanish fast.

Provided by Quaker Oats Company

Total Time 30 minutes

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 10 minutes

Yield Makes about 4 dozen cookies

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 cups plus 6 tablespoons butter, softened
3/4 cups firmly packed brown sugar
1/2 cups granulated sugar
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on salt (optional)
3 cups Quaker Oats (quick or old fashioned, uncooked)
1 cup raisins

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F.
  • In large bowl, beat butter and sugars on medium speed of electric mixer until creamy. Add eggs and vanilla; beat well. Add combined flour, baking soda, cinnamon, and salt; mix well. Add oats and raisins; mix well.
  • Drop dough by rounded tablespoonfuls onto ungreased cookie sheets.
  • Bake 8 to 10 minutes or until light golden brown. Cool 1 minute on cookie sheets; remove to wire rack. Cool completely. Store tightly covered.

QUAKER OATMEAL COOKIES RECIPE - FOOD.COM



Quaker Oatmeal Cookies Recipe - Food.com image

Mom used the recipe straight off the box of the Quaker Oatmeal canister. This has always been extra special because of the warm thoughts it brings to me of my Aunt Marshee who worked at the Quaker Oatmeal plant as an executive assistant for most of her professional career.

Total Time 25 minutes

Prep Time 10 minutes

Cook Time 15 minutes

Yield 4 dozen, 48 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

3/4 cup shortening
1 cup brown sugar
1/2 cup white sugar
1 egg
1/4 cup water
1 teaspoon vanilla
3 cups oats, uncooked
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1 cup raisins
1/2-1 cup nuts, chopped

Steps:

  • Beat together shortening, sugars, egg, water and vanilla until creamy.
  • Add combined remaining ingredients; mix well.
  • Add raisins, nuts or even chocolate chips at the end.
  • Drop by teaspoonfuls onto greased cookie sheets.
  • Bake at 350 degrees for 12-15 minutes.
